UR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ID3
Нить номер: 102302
[ Назад ]

Исходное сообщение
"Увидела свет система управления списками рассылки GNU Mailma..."

Отправлено opennews , 29-Апр-15 10:16 
После 7 лет разработки анонсирован (https://mail.python.org/pipermail/mailman-announce/2015-Apri...) значительный релиз системы управления почтовыми рассылками GNU Mailman 3.0 (http://wiki.list.org/Mailman3), используемой для организации общения разработчиков в большом числе открытых проектов. В новом выпуске отмечаются кардинальные изменения, выразившиеся в переработке архитектуры системы в набор взаимодействующих друг с другом и заменяемых компонентов.  Выпуск 3.0 опубликован под лицензией GPLv3.


Основной движок (Mailman Core (https://pypi.python.org/pypi/mailman)), осуществляющий управление пользователями, доставку, обработку и модерацию сообщений, теперь использует реляционную СУБД для хранения базы пользовательской  и взаимодействует с остальными компонентами через управляющий REST+JSON API.  Из видимых пользователю изменений можно отметить созданный с нуля новый web-интерфейс Postorius (https://pypi.python.org/pypi/postorius) для пользователей и администраторов, построенный с использованием фреймворка Django и позволяющий отправлять сообщения в рассылку через Web, работая наподобие web-форума. Также представлены новый web-интерфейс доступа к архиву рассылки HyperKitty (https://pypi.python.org/pypi/HyperKitty), в которые добавлены встроенные механизмы поиска по базе ранее опубликованных сообщений.


Из других изменений можно отметить полноценную поддержку нескольких доменов (для каждого домена могут обрабатываться разные рассылки с одинаковыми именами), единый аккаунт для управления всеми подписками пользователя, хранение информации о паролях в форме хэшей (напоминания о необходимости ежемесячной смены пароля ушли в прошлое).
Для сборки представлен новый набор скриптов mailman-bundler,  позволяющий легко сформировать рабочую конфигурацию Mailman в виртуальном окружении с Python. Для создания собственных надстроек и обеспечения интеграции с Mailman сторонних проектов подготовлена библиотека mailman.client (https://pypi.python.org/pypi/mailmanclient). Для работы базовой части требуется Python 3.4, при том, что для web-интерфейса, mailman.client и HyperKitty по-прежнему достаточно Python 2.7.


URL: http://permalink.gmane.org/gmane.comp.python.announce/11879
Новость: http://www.opennet.me/opennews/art.shtml?num=42127


Содержание

Сообщения в этом обсуждении
"Увидела свет система управления списками рассылки GNU Mailma..."
Отправлено Собака , 29-Апр-15 10:16 
Правильно ли я понял, что по возможностям он сейчас близок к google groups?

"Увидела свет система управления списками рассылки GNU Mailma..."
Отправлено Аноним , 29-Апр-15 10:17 
Иными словами, вместо генерации архива в статике, он теперь будет выводится динамически со всеми свойственными этому проблемами?

Переход от статики к динамике и хранение в СУБД потребует обновления сервера. Если раньше для отдачи статики справлялся дохлый celeron, то с новым mailman такое не пройдёт. И потроха наружу тоже не гуд, его в любой момент могут сломать через какую-нибудь 0-day уязвимость.


"Увидела свет система управления списками рассылки GNU Mailma..."
Отправлено myhand , 30-Апр-15 12:08 
модно-молодежно

"Увидела свет система управления списками рассылки GNU Mailma..."
Отправлено Аноним , 30-Апр-15 18:40 
Вы это это? http://mlmmj.org/

"Увидела свет система управления списками рассылки GNU Mailma..."
Отправлено Аноним , 29-Апр-15 18:26 
Подскажите бесплатные хостинги с mailman? Уж очень нравится навигация по тредам